What is Lumanu and how does it work?

Lumanu provides invoicing infrastructure for creator brand deals. Creators send professional invoices to brands through Lumanu, track payment status, and optionally access EarlyPay — a feature that advances the invoice amount immediately (minus a fee) rather than waiting for the brand to pay on their net-30 or net-60 terms. Lumanu then collects from the brand when the normal payment window arrives.

Lumanu standout strengths

The cash flow problem is real. A creator who completes a $5,000 brand deal in January but doesn't receive payment until March has a genuine business problem — bills, taxes, and new investments can't wait 60 days. EarlyPay essentially functions as factoring (buying the invoice) at a cost, which is a well-established financial tool that Lumanu has made accessible to creators. For creators with large deals and cash flow needs, the fee is worth paying.

Lumanu weaknesses and drawbacks

The EarlyPay fee reduces the effective deal rate — understand the cost before using it. For creators with healthy cash flow and modest brand deal income, free invoicing tools (Wave, FreshBooks) plus standard payment waiting periods may be sufficient. Lumanu's value is specifically in the EarlyPay feature; the basic invoicing is a means to that end, not a significant standalone differentiator.

Frequently Asked Questions about Lumanu

How much does EarlyPay cost?

EarlyPay charges a percentage of the invoice amount for early access. Check current rates — fees vary based on invoice size and payment timing.

Is Lumanu's basic invoicing really free?

Yes — Lumanu's invoicing, payment tracking, and tax form management are free. EarlyPay is the premium paid feature.
